Пример #1
0
        protected override void InnerExecute(string[] arguments)
        {
            var application = _client.GetApplication(ApplicationId);

            _writer.WriteLine("Id: {0}", application.Slug);
            _writer.WriteLine("Name: {0}", application.Name);
            _writer.WriteLine("Region: {0}", application.RegionIdentifier);
        }
Пример #2
0
        protected override void InnerExecute(string[] arguments)
        {
            if (arguments.Length == 0)
            {
                throw new CommandException("Please specify an application id.");
            }

            var user = _appharborClient.GetUser();

            Application application;

            try
            {
                application = _appharborClient.GetApplication(arguments[0]);
            }
            catch (ApiException)
            {
                throw new CommandException("The application could not be found");
            }

            _applicationConfiguration.SetupApplication(application.Slug, user);
        }